About this role
Vice President Environmental Health & Safety Department is a senior executive role that sets strategy and owns results across the function, focused on Environmental Health & Safety in the Technical job family. The title carries Department-level responsibility, indicating a department scope within a single function.
The Technical function covers specialized engineering and technical disciplines that support an organization's products and infrastructure.
Typical experience: 15 to 22 years at the Vice President level, per widely used corporate career-level norms (Radford, Mercer, and SHRM career-level frameworks). Actual expectations vary by function, industry, and company size.
Lead a function across the enterprise or an entire business unit
Set functional vision, strategy, and multi-year roadmap
Serve on the executive leadership team
Own functional P&L and enterprise-wide outcomes for the area
Interface with the board, executive committee, and external partners
Build and lead a team of Directors and their organizations
FLSA classification (typical)
Typically Exempt · Executive exemption
Managerial roles at this level typically qualify for the Executive exemption because they customarily direct the work of two or more full-time employees and have authority over hiring, firing, or promotion decisions. Actual classification depends on the specific job duties, salary basis, and any applicable state or local rules. The current federal salary threshold for exemption is $684 per week ($35,568 per year), per the 2020 Department of Labor rule; the 2024 rule that would have raised the threshold was struck down by federal court in November 2024.
